Course review:

  • Basic characters and types of analogical modulations of signals
  • Amplitude modulation and influence of noise on amplitude-modulated signals
  • Phase modulation and influence of noise on phase-modulated signals
  • Sampling and impulse modulations of signals
  • Quantization and digital modulations of signals
  • Many-channel signals
  • Definition and basic terms of theory of information, information and its quantitative measures, mathematical inequalities in theory of information
  • Basic types and properties of information entropy
  • Mean transinformation and its properties
  • Coding and redundancy of information
  • Transmission of information via discrete channel
  • Transmission of information via continuous channel
  • Relationship between information and thermodynamical entropy
